John J. Miller, Jr., age 75, of Jefferson City, passed away Sunday, November 11, 2018 at U.T. Medical Center in Knoxville. He was born on March 18, 1943 in New Kensington, PA. He was the much loved son of the late Catherine F. and John J. Miller. He is survived by his wonderful wife, Rebecca C. Miller; sisters, Betty Jane (Richard) Wicks of Willow Grove, PA and Mae Louise (James) Woomer of Nashville; and a niece and nephew. Mr. Miller came to Morristown in 1986 to set up the ceramic core facility of Howmet, now Alcoa/Howmet, and was the unit manager for the ceramic core operation. The time at Howmet was cherished by John including the people that worked for him on staff and on the plant floor. High quality, low costs, and hard work were important factors in the success that came to the operation. In later years, John worked as an appraiser assistant at Blackburn Appraisals in Morristown. He also volunteered at Appalachian Outreach in Jefferson City. Mr. Miller graduated from Penn State with a BS in Ceramic Technology and went on to earn a PhD in Materials at Rensselaer Polytechnic University in Troy, NY and a Master of Arts in Business Administration at Baldwin-Wallace College, Berea, OH.
